Cornwall Development Company has announced that former Olympic Medallist Roger Black MBE will be the keynote speaker for the Cornwall Business Awards 2012, the most prestigious business awards event in the county.
Suzanne Bond, Chief Executive of Cornwall Development Company, Cornwall Council’s economic development company, says: “The year the UK is hosting London 2012 is a great time to mark the similarities between high performance in sport and high performance in business.
And the fact that the Olympic torch is starting its UK journey in Cornwall in the same week as the Cornwall Business Awards in May 2012 makes it especially appropriate. We are thrilled that Roger Black will be our speaker this year.”
Roger Black MBE represented Great Britain at the highest level in the world of athletics, both as an individual 400 metre runner and as a member of the 4x400 metre relay team, winning fifteen major Championship medals. His greatest achievement was winning the Olympics 400 metre Silver medal in Atlanta in 1996 and he is currently a Team GB 2012 Ambassador.

Suzanne Bond continues: “This is the seventh year that Cornwall Development Company has staged the Cornwall Business Awards. Yet again, we look set for a bumper year. We have already received an inspiring range of entries from businesses of all kinds and sizes and we are looking forward to seeing many more before the deadline in mid March.”
Around 350 business leaders are expected to attend the awards dinner at St Mellion International Resort on 17th May, with live video streaming being used to share the results around the world.
Any business based in Cornwall or the Isles of Scilly can enter one or more of fourteen award categories, which include Young Business Person of the Year, Best New Business in Cornwall and Most Creative Use of Design.
A new award category this year is ‘Best Use of Superfast Broadband’.
